How they compare

Uruguay currently reports 52.4% against 49.0% in Mongolia, a difference of 3.4%.

That makes Uruguay's figure about 1.1 times Mongolia's.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 7 shared years of data; in 2009 it was Uruguay ahead.

Mongolia ranks 11th and Uruguay ranks 8th of 32 countries.

Uruguay has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Mongolia Uruguay Difference Ahead
2000s 33.9% 45.0% 11.1% Uruguay
2010s 35.0% 46.5% 11.4% Uruguay
2020s 49.0% 52.8% 3.8% Uruguay

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
